What is Key Programming?
Key programming refers to the procedure of configuring or reprogramming electronic keys, also referred to as transponder keys, and remote entry fobs. These keys include ingrained microchips that communicate with the vehicle's or property's onboard computer to allow access or operations. Key programming is essential when keys are lost, harmed, or when a new key is required to boost security.

The key programming process generally includes the following steps:
Identification: The technician determines the make and model of the vehicle or security system to figure out the correct programming approaches.Accessing the System: Using specific diagnostic tools or software application, the technician links to the vehicle's or system's onboard computer.Inputting the Code: The technician inputs the required code or signal from the new key or fob to develop communication with the system.Evaluating: The key is then evaluated to guarantee it can unlock doors, start the ignition, and perform any other designated functions.Advantages of Key Programming Services

Can I configure keys myself?
Some cars permit self-programming, but the majority of require specific tools and understanding for precise programming. It is suggested to consult a professional service for best outcomes.
The length of time does the key programming procedure take?
The procedure can generally be completed within 30 minutes to a couple of hours, depending on the intricacy of the vehicle or security system.
